Abstract

PURPOSE: To sense a vibration phase highly accurately by analyzing the frequency of vibration waveform, taking out only the rotational frequency component, synchronizing said frequency with the rotating phase of a rotary shaft and the rotating frequency, performing sampling, and performing discrete Fourier transformation of said signal.
CONSTITUTION: A shaft vibration signal 101 is converted into a digital shaft vibration signal 102 by an A/D converter incorporating a sample holder, and further transformed to a frequency spectral signal 103 by a Fourier transformer 15. A rotary pulse gear 7 and a phase reference pulse gear 8 are attached to the end part of a rotor shaft 11. A rotating pulse signal 105 and a phase reference pulse signal 106, which are obtained by electromagnetic pickups 9 and 10, are sensed. A sampling timing signal 107 which is proportional to the frequency of the rotating pulse signal is applied from a timing circuit 17 to the A/D converter 14 from the time point of the application of the phase reference pulse. In this constitution, the phase does not change at any number of rotation or at any time point of analysis, and the vibration can be sensed highly accurately.
